Coderoot Privacy Policy

Last updated: May 15, 2026

Coderoot is a Chrome Extension that adds advanced concept notes to supported Codetree introduction pages. This policy explains what information Coderoot handles and why.

How the information is used

Coderoot uses this information only to provide its single purpose: loading, previewing, editing, and saving Coderoot XML concept notes for Codetree pages.

When a contributor saves XML content, the deployed Coderoot API writes the change to the Coderoot content repository through the installed GitHub App. Approved XML content may become public in the Coderoot content repository.

Remote content and code

Coderoot fetches XML notes and GitHub metadata from remote services as data. The extension does not execute remotely hosted JavaScript. Extension JavaScript and CSS are packaged inside the extension.

Sharing and sale of data

Coderoot does not sell user data. Coderoot does not transfer user data to third parties for advertising, creditworthiness, or unrelated purposes.

Data retention

Coderoot session data may be stored locally by the extension and can be cleared by removing the extension or clearing extension storage. XML content saved to GitHub follows the retention and history behavior of the Coderoot content repository.
